Yes, a Saab is a truly unique car. You may be frustrated with the cost of repairs, the difficulty of finding a good mechanic (depending on where you live), the quirks they develop as they age, but after driving one you won't care. These cars are addictive and embody something that very few mass production automobiles still have - a true love of the road. My first car was a 1976 99GL. It was a cream sedan with rust colored interior. I got it 1986 and cosmetically it was absolutely flawless. It looked new. When I pulled it into the local Saab dealership for a tune up, the salesmen all gathered around and couldn't believe the condition. I really loved that car. Despite the cosmetics, the mechanics were a nightmare and in two years I spent over 3K in repairs. Still, I love that car. It drove like nothing else and I felt fantastic in it. No Honda or Toyota can compare. The 94 - 98 900's are much more dependable and are a real treat to drive. They are still expensive to repair, but the tradeoff is worth it if you want a serious - and safe - automobile. Try a 9-3 if you can. Saab has a great, affordable leasing program as well, which takes care of repairs. Also, check out Saab's website. The graphic design alone makes it worth a visit.
